In the pantheon of luxury perfumery, few names command the reverence of Clive Christian. Established in 1999 with the audacious No.1—once crowned the world’s most expensive fragrance—the house has consistently pushed the boundaries of opulence and craftsmanship. Clive Christian X for Women, launched in 2001, represents a pivotal moment in the brand’s evolution: a fruity-chypre that marries the exuberance of late-20th-century gourmands with the classical structure of a green floral.

Composed by Patricia Choux, a perfumer of considerable skill at Givaudan, X for Women is a study in controlled decadence. It opens with a burst of peach, pineapple, and rhubarb—a triad that is simultaneously sweet and tart—before settling into a heart of white florals and iris. The base, anchored by patchouli and labdanum, provides a woody, earthy foundation that tempers the fruit’s exuberance. The result is a fragrance that feels both lavish and composed, a paradox that defines Clive Christian’s aesthetic.

7/10 — The fragrance is elegant and distinctive, often eliciting compliments from those who appreciate niche perfumery, though its moderate projection means it may not garner attention in crowded spaces.

Pros & Cons

  • ✅ Exceptional longevity (12+ hours) with a slow, graceful dry-down
  • ✅ Complex, well-balanced composition that avoids cloying sweetness
  • ✅ Versatile enough for both day and evening wear across multiple seasons
  • ✅ High-quality ingredients that justify the luxury price point
  • ❌ Price point is steep (€360 for 50ml), limiting accessibility
  • ❌ Projection is soft to moderate; may not satisfy those who prefer strong sillage
  • ❌ The fruity opening may feel dated to some modern palates accustomed to fresher styles

🏆 Final Verdict

Clive Christian X for Women is a masterful fruity-chypre that balances opulence with restraint. Its longevity and complexity make it a worthy investment for collectors, though its moderate projection and high price may deter casual buyers. For those who appreciate the artistry of Patricia Choux and the heritage of Clive Christian, this is a fragrance that rewards patience and close attention.
